Property Description

Historic Charm and Modern Comforts

Original Features and Cozy Atmosphere
Experience the charm of a 1403 coaching inn with oak beams, open log fire, and modern amenities like free WiFi and TV in each room.

Delicious Dining and Cocktail Delights
Indulge in a full English breakfast and continental buffet, then unwind at the cocktail bar with a selection of Classic and Signature cocktails, local beers, and wines.

Convenient Location and Easy Access
Just 2 minutes from the city center and a short walk to Canterbury West Rail Station and the stunning Norman cathedral. Book now for a memorable stay at The Falstaff.

W
Wander54957185553 Couples Chorleywood, Hertfordshire, England
8
Mini break
Pros:

The hotel is in a very central location, which was convenient for getting around. The staff were very friendly and helpful. However, the room was quite small and had very limited storage, making it difficult to keep belongings organised.

Unfortunately, the bathroom was disappointing. There was visible mould and dark buildup around the shower seals and corners, and the overall condition of the bathroom suggested that it needed a more thorough deep clean and some maintenance.

The location is a positive, but the small room, lack of storage, and mouldy bathroom made the stay less comfortable than expected.
